Sports Analytics Market to Reach USD 17.88 Billion by 2031 as AI, IoT and Cloud Adoption Accelerate

The global sports analytics market is projected to grow from USD 5.28 billion in 2026 to USD 17.88 billion by 2031, registering a compound annual growth rate of 27.63%. Market expansion is being driven by rising investment in artificial intelligence, real-time player tracking, cloud analytics, biometric monitoring and data-supported decision-making across professional sports.

Sports teams, leagues, federations, athletes and betting operators are increasingly using advanced analytics to improve performance, support recruitment, reduce injury risks, strengthen officiating and create more engaging broadcast experiences. Demand is also rising for integrated platforms that combine positional data, video, wearable sensor feeds, ticketing information and betting data.

Real-Time Sports Analytics Reshapes Professional Leagues

North American professional leagues remain at the forefront of real-time sports analytics adoption. Zebra RFID chips embedded in NFL shoulder pads and optical tracking cameras installed in NBA arenas generate millions of coordinates during each game. These technologies have reduced analysis cycles from hours to seconds, enabling coaches and performance teams to act on live insights.

Microsoft’s Copilot-enabled sideline application, introduced league-wide in August 2025, converts live data streams into fourth-down probabilities, fatigue alerts and other actionable intelligence. The need for immediate analysis is encouraging teams to replace fixed data centers with edge gateways and low-latency cloud infrastructure. Similar adoption is emerging in European football following the English Premier League’s five-year artificial intelligence partnership with Microsoft, announced in July 2025.

Football Clubs Prioritize Centralized Data Warehousing

Football generated 39.78% of sports analytics market revenue in 2025. Premier League and continental European clubs increasingly view multi-season performance archives as strategic assets that can support player recruitment and transfer valuation. Oracle’s Match Insights platform consolidates video, positional and biometric records, allowing recruitment teams to compare prospective signings with historical performance benchmarks.

Academy systems are adopting the same data-led approach. Kitman Labs supports longitudinal player tracking across Premier League youth programs, strengthening talent development and helping clubs make evidence-based decisions. As centralized sports data platforms become more important during transfer negotiations, clubs without comparable analytics capabilities face a greater risk of mispricing players.

Rugby Records Rapid Analytics Adoption

Rugby is forecast to be the fastest-growing sport segment, advancing at a 29.23% CAGR through 2031. Sportable’s sensor-enabled Gilbert rugby ball supplies 20 positional updates per second, supporting real-time verification of lineouts and forward passes while producing data for broadcast graphics and fan engagement.

Trials conducted during the 2023 Under-20 World Championship encouraged Six Nations organizers to deploy smart-ball technology through 2029. The rollout is expected to generate sustained demand for sports analytics software, connected hardware and professional services. Cricket remains the second-largest sport segment, supported by Hawk-Eye adoption in India and Australia, while basketball continues to expand its use of spatial tracking.

Software Leads as Integration Services Gain Momentum

Software represented 64.89% of market value in 2025, reflecting strong demand for performance analysis, video intelligence, player tracking and fan engagement platforms. Services, however, are projected to expand at a 28.11% CAGR as sports organizations seek assistance with data integration, model training, cybersecurity, privacy compliance and cloud migration.

Deloitte’s Converge for Sports combines fan data, loyalty capabilities and real-time dashboards in a managed service environment. This model reflects a broader shift toward outcome-based contracts rather than standalone technology purchases. Vendors that combine software licenses with consulting and integration services are well positioned to benefit from the increasing complexity of modern sports technology environments.

Regional Sports Analytics Market Outlook

North America accounted for 42.76% of global revenue in 2025. Growth is supported by the NFL’s connected tracking infrastructure, mature broadband networks, significant media rights revenue and widespread legal sports wagering. Major League Baseball’s long-term agreement with Sportradar further demonstrates the strategic value of official sports data partnerships.

Europe ranked as the second-largest regional market, driven by football analytics, centralized data strategies and advanced broadcast applications. Data privacy requirements, including GDPR obligations for biometric information, can lengthen implementation timelines. Nevertheless, major technology partnerships indicate that European clubs remain willing to invest when compliance processes are standardized.

Asia-Pacific is forecast to record the fastest regional growth, with a 28.69% CAGR through 2031. Expansion is being led by franchise cricket, esports and recurring investment in tracking systems. Indian Premier League clubs maintain Hawk-Eye and Catapult technologies, supporting regular software upgrades. China, Japan and South Korea are also integrating traditional sports data with esports telemetry to create advanced coaching and broadcasting dashboards.

South America and Africa are expected to maintain double-digit growth from smaller revenue bases. Limited technology budgets and inconsistent connectivity continue to restrict adoption among second-division clubs. However, leading organizations in Sao Paulo, Buenos Aires and Johannesburg are deploying wearables and cloud-based sports analytics platforms comparable with those used by major European teams. Infrastructure investment and new regional broadcasting agreements are expected to support broader adoption.

Market Opportunities and Constraints

Additional growth opportunities include sports betting data partnerships following legalization in the United States and franchise-driven analytics adoption in Indian and Australian cricket leagues. Key constraints include biometric data requirements under GDPR and the California Consumer Privacy Act, limited budgets among tier-2 clubs, and the technical challenges associated with integrating multiple data sources.

Despite these barriers, the sports analytics market is positioned for strong expansion through 2031. Organizations that successfully combine artificial intelligence, IoT sensors, cloud infrastructure and specialized integration services will be best equipped to improve competitive performance, commercialize sports data and deliver richer experiences for fans, broadcasters and betting audiences.
